Presentation Transcript


  1. Five Approaches to Multicultural Education Carl Grant & Christine Sleeter

  2. Teaching the Culturally Different • Assimilate the culturally different into the mainstream • “Transitional Bridges” into existing school structures • Modify approaches to make it more accessible.

  3. Human Relations • Development of good human relations between groups • Provide information to help one group understand others

  4. Single-Group Studies • Focuses on one group for study • Promotes understanding for those of other groups • Promotes pride for those of same group

  5. Multicultural Education • Promotes strength and values of different cultural groups • Promotes human rights and social justice • Promotes respect for diversity • Promotes alternate life choices • Promotes equity among social groups

  6. Multicultural and Social Reconstruction • Promotes understanding of social structures of power • Encourages social action for changing inequalities
